World Championship Boat Angling 2007; Eric Goossens is the new World Champion!
From tuesday second to thursday fourth of October the Belgium town of Blankenberge was the location of the World Championship Boatangling 2007. All international top anglers competed in the match, a Dutch team also fished the World Championships. For Eric Goossens, one of the first Dutch Team members and SPRO / Gamakatsu fieldtester, the match was extra exciting as he promised the coach Wil Franken to become the new World Champion before the start of the first day. And a promise must be followed...
During the first day Eric had a nice result finishing first on his boat, which made him ninth in the individual ranking. After a calm first day near the ‘Den Haan’ coast, the second day became a home match for the Dutch; the official training location was visited again. . Eric Goossens excelled here with the amazing catch of 26 kilo, that made him winner of the day and brought him to the first place. In the Team Classification, the Dutch team rose to the fifth position before the end of the last day.
Eric Goossens showed his strength as an allround sea angler, the SPRO / Gamakatsu angler ended second on his boat with 9,9kg. This result turned out to be sufficient to keep the first place; Eric ended above the German Jens Hapke & Slovenian Dejan Struna, which became second and third. The Netherlands ended fourth just after Spain, England & Germany. Eric’s promise has been fulfilled; he showed on the World Championship Boat Angling that the Netherlands is part of the world’s top!
